WebSep 25, 2024 · There are several techniques for estimating health state utility values, each of which presents pros and cons in the context of rare diseases (RDs). Direct approaches (e.g. standard gamble and time trade-off) may be too demanding for patients with RDs, since most of them affect young children or cause cognitive impairment. ... buckeye health plan providers number

WebSSI utility decrements ranged from 0.04 to 0.48, of which 19 ranged from 0.1 to 0.3. SSI utility decrements could be calculated for three patient-level studies, and their values ranged from 0.05 (7 days postoperatively) to 0.124 (1 year postoperatively). WebJan 18, 2024 · The health utility values for the same health outcome or health state can vary substantially depending on the method of health utility estimation, the population used to derive utility scores (patients, caregivers, health professionals, or the general public), and the context (setting, method or mode of administration, or description of health state).
